Construction Change Order Best Management Practices. Definition of a construction change order: A construction change order is work that is added to or deleted from the originally agreed upon and contracted scope of work which alters the original contract amount and/or completion date. Is a BIM Mandate Coming to the US?

Viewpoint Construction Technology

In 2010, for example, Wisconsin became the first state to require BIM on publicly-funded projects with a budget over $5 million. Even more locally, the Los Angeles Community College District (LACCD) has required BIM be used on a sustainable building project that’s funded through a taxpayer-approved bond.
